Researchers gave homeless people $750 per month for a year, no questions asked. The recipients spent the money on food, housing, transportation, clothing, and health care. And after six months, only 12% of those who received funds were still homeless.

Ohio Secretary of State Frank LaRose said that he himself "worked extensively" on drafting the ballot language for Ohio's reproductive rights amendment on the November ballot. It includes numerous inaccuracies and fails to mention contraception, fertility treatment, and others.
